Computer >> คอมพิวเตอร์ >  >> การเขียนโปรแกรม >> MySQL

ใช้ตัวเลือกบนบรรทัดคำสั่งสำหรับโปรแกรม MySQL หรือไม่


ให้เราเข้าใจวิธีใช้ตัวเลือกบนบรรทัดคำสั่งสำหรับโปรแกรม MySQL -

ตัวเลือกโปรแกรมที่ระบุไว้ในบรรทัดคำสั่งเป็นไปตามกฎด้านล่าง -

  • ตัวเลือกจะได้รับหลังชื่อคำสั่ง

  • อาร์กิวเมนต์ option เริ่มต้นด้วยหนึ่งขีดหรือสองขีด และขึ้นอยู่กับว่าชื่อตัวเลือกเป็นแบบสั้นหรือแบบยาว

  • หลายตัวเลือกมีทั้งแบบสั้นและแบบยาว เรามาดูตัวอย่างเพื่อทำความเข้าใจเรื่องนี้กัน − ? และ −−help เป็นรูปแบบสั้นและยาวของตัวเลือกที่สั่งให้โปรแกรม MySQL แสดงข้อความช่วยเหลือ

  • ชื่อตัวเลือกจะคำนึงถึงขนาดตัวพิมพ์ ทั้ง −v และ −V ถูกกฎหมายแต่มีความหมายต่างกัน

  • พวกมันคือรูปแบบสั้นๆ ตามลำดับของตัวเลือก −−verbose และ −−version

บางตัวเลือกใช้ค่าตามชื่อตัวเลือก ให้เรายกตัวอย่างเพื่อทำความเข้าใจสิ่งนี้ -

ตัวอย่าง

−h localhost or −−host=localhost show the MySQL server host to a client program.

ค่าตัวเลือกให้ข้อมูลแก่โปรแกรมเกี่ยวกับชื่อของโฮสต์ที่เซิร์ฟเวอร์ MySQL กำลังทำงานอยู่

เซิร์ฟเวอร์ MySQL มีตัวเลือกคำสั่งบางอย่างที่สามารถระบุได้เฉพาะเมื่อเริ่มต้น และชุดของตัวแปรระบบ ซึ่งบางส่วนสามารถตั้งค่าได้เมื่อเริ่มต้น ที่รันไทม์ หรือทั้งสองอย่าง

ชื่อตัวแปรของระบบใช้ขีดล่างแทนขีดกลาง เมื่ออ้างอิงขณะรันไทม์ จะต้องเขียนโดยใช้ขีดล่างดังที่แสดงด้านล่าง −

สอบถาม

SET GLOBAL general_log = ON;
SELECT @@GLOBAL.general_log;

ระหว่างการเริ่มต้นเซิร์ฟเวอร์ ไวยากรณ์สำหรับตัวแปรระบบจะเหมือนกับตัวเลือกคำสั่ง ดังนั้นภายในชื่อตัวแปร อาจใช้ขีดกลางและขีดล่างแทนกันได้